# ImToken 钱包 API 权限:安全与便捷的平衡之道,ImToken 钱包 API 权限在保障安全与提供便捷间寻求平衡,需严格权限管理以防范风险,如对数据访问、交易操作等权限精准把控;又要兼顾用户体验,让开发者能高效调用 API 实现功能拓展,合理设置权限层级、加密传输数据等措施,可在确保资产安全的同时,提升 API 使用的便捷性,推动区块链应用生态发展。
在数字资产如日中天的时代浪潮中,ImToken 钱包作为一款声名远扬的加密货币钱包应用,宛如一座坚固的桥梁,为用户搭建起管理数字资产的便捷通道,而 API(应用程序接口)权限,恰似桥梁的关键枢纽,不仅紧紧系着用户数字资产的安全命脉,更如灵动的画笔,描绘着开发者基于钱包进行创新应用开发的无限可能,深入钻研 ImToken 钱包 API 权限,无疑是为保障数字资产生态的健康蓬勃发展点亮了一盏明灯。
ImToken 钱包 API 权限的定义与作用
(一)定义
ImToken 钱包 API 权限,犹如一把精密的数字钥匙,是开发者凭借特定的接口协议,被赋予的与 ImToken 钱包展开交互操作的一系列权利集合,这些权利丰富多样,从获取用户钱包地址的基础信息,到查询资产余额的精准洞察,再到发起交易请求的关键操作,无一不涵盖其中。
(二)作用
- 促进应用开发:对于开发者而言,API 权限宛如一把神奇的密钥,轻轻开启数字资产世界的大门,它赋予开发者基于 ImToken 钱包构建创新应用的能力,无论是去中心化金融(DeFi)应用的蓬勃兴起,还是数字身份认证应用的崭露头角,都离不开 API 权限的助力,以 DeFi 借贷应用为例,它能通过 API 权限获取用户的资产信息,精准评估用户的借贷能力,从而为用户量身定制个性化的借贷服务,让金融服务更加贴合用户需求。
- 提升用户体验:从用户视角出发,API 权限的合理开放,如同为用户铺设了一条数字资产使用的快车道,在支持 ImToken 钱包 API 的电商平台上,用户无需繁琐地手动输入钱包地址等操作,便能快速完成加密货币支付,让购物体验更加流畅便捷,这种便捷性的提升,无疑增强了用户对数字资产应用的满意度和忠诚度。
- 推动行业创新:ImToken 钱包 API 权限的开放,如同一颗强大的磁石,吸引着众多开发者投身于数字资产相关的创新开发领域,这股创新的热潮,加速了行业内新技术、新应用如雨后春笋般涌现,推动整个数字资产行业如奔腾的骏马,不断向前迈进,开创更加辉煌的未来。
ImToken 钱包 API 权限的类型
(一)只读权限
- 资产查询权限:开发者借助该权限,如同拥有了一双透视眼,能够获取用户钱包内各种加密货币的余额信息,以加密货币行情分析应用为例,它巧妙利用此权限,为用户提供其持有的加密货币的实时价值评估,让用户随时掌握资产动态,做出明智的投资决策。
- 交易记录查询权限:此权限允许开发者获取用户钱包的交易历史记录,对于财务管理应用而言,这是一座宝贵的信息金矿,它们通过深入分析交易记录,为用户精心生成详细的资产收支报告,帮助用户清晰了解资产的来龙去脉,实现更加科学的财务管理。
(二)读写权限
- 交易发起权限:这是一把双刃剑,虽敏感却极具价值,开发者可代表用户发起加密货币交易,如转账、支付等操作,在去中心化交易所应用中,用户授权后,应用通过该权限自动执行交易指令,让交易更加高效快捷,同时也为用户带来了全新的交易体验。
- 智能合约交互权限:随着区块链智能合约的广泛应用,此权限如同一把灵动的钥匙,允许开发者与 ImToken 钱包内的智能合约进行深度交互,在基于区块链的供应链溯源应用中,开发者通过该权限调用智能合约,精准记录商品的流转信息,让供应链管理更加透明可信,为消费者提供了更可靠的商品溯源保障。
ImToken 钱包 API 权限的安全考量
(一)用户隐私保护
- 数据加密传输:ImToken 钱包在赋予 API 权限时,必须筑牢数据安全的防线,确保用户数据在传输过程中的加密,采用先进的加密算法,如 SSL/TLS 协议,如同为数据穿上了一层坚固的铠甲,防止数据被窃取或篡改,用户的钱包地址、资产余额等敏感信息在通过 API 传输时,应进行高强度加密,只有授权的应用才能解密,保障用户隐私不被泄露。
- 最小权限原则:遵循“最小权限原则”,如同量体裁衣,只授予开发者完成特定功能所必需的权限,对于仅用于展示加密货币行情的应用,不应授予交易发起权限,这样可以最大程度减少用户隐私泄露的风险,让权限分配更加精准合理。
(二)防止恶意攻击
- 身份验证机制:建立严格的身份验证机制,如同设置了一道坚固的门禁,确保只有合法的开发者和应用才能获取 API 权限,采用 API 密钥、OAuth 2.0 等认证方式,开发者在申请 API 权限时,需提供详细的应用信息和身份验证资料,经过 ImToken 官方审核通过后,才能获得相应的 API 密钥,从源头上杜绝恶意访问。
- 访问控制与监控:对 API 权限的访问进行实时监控和控制,如同安装了一双敏锐的眼睛,设置访问频率限制、IP 白名单等措施,限制每个 API 密钥每分钟的调用次数,防止恶意应用通过高频调用 API 进行攻击,建立日志记录系统,对 API 的访问行为进行详细记录,以便及时发现异常行为并采取措施,让 API 访问更加安全可控。
(三)智能合约安全
- 代码审计:对于涉及智能合约交互权限的 API,ImToken 应加强对智能合约代码的审计,如同进行一次全面的身体检查,邀请专业的安全审计团队对智能合约代码进行全面检查,发现并修复潜在的安全漏洞,如检查智能合约是否存在重入攻击、整数溢出等常见漏洞,确保智能合约的安全可靠。
- 版本管理与更新:随着区块链技术的飞速发展和安全威胁的不断演变,智能合约需要不断更新和优化,如同给软件打补丁,ImToken 应建立完善的智能合约版本管理机制,及时推送安全更新,确保用户和开发者使用的智能合约始终处于安全状态,为智能合约的稳定运行保驾护航。
ImToken 钱包 API 权限的管理与优化
(一)权限申请流程优化
- 简化申请步骤:针对一些开发者反映的 ImToken 钱包 API 权限申请流程繁琐问题,如同优化一条复杂的道路,通过优化申请界面,采用引导式申请流程,让开发者清晰明了所需提交的资料和步骤,将申请资料分为必填项和选填项,必填项提供清晰的填写示例,减少开发者的困惑,让申请流程更加简洁高效。
- 加快审核速度:建立高效的审核团队,如同组建一支精锐的部队,采用自动化审核与人工审核相结合的方式,对于简单的权限申请,如只读权限,通过自动化审核快速处理;对于涉及读写权限等敏感申请,再进行人工详细审核,向开发者提供审核进度查询功能,让开发者及时了解申请状态,提高审核效率和透明度。
(二)权限文档完善
- 详细的 API 文档:提供更加详细、易懂的 API 权限文档,如同绘制一幅精准的地图,除了技术参数说明外,增加实际应用案例和代码示例,对于交易发起权限的 API,不仅说明接口的输入输出参数,还提供完整的交易发起代码示例,让开发者更容易理解和使用,降低开发门槛。
- 多语言支持:考虑到全球开发者的需求,ImToken 应提供多语言版本的 API 权限文档,如同搭建一座语言的桥梁,除了英语和中文外,逐步增加其他常用语言版本,如日语、韩语、西班牙语等,方便不同国家和地区的开发者使用,扩大 API 的影响力和覆盖面。
(三)开发者社区建设
- 建立开发者论坛:创建专门的 ImToken 钱包 API 开发者论坛,如同打造一个交流的广场,为开发者提供交流平台,开发者可以在论坛上分享开发经验、解决技术难题、提出对 API 权限的改进建议,ImToken 官方也可以通过论坛及时了解开发者的需求和反馈,促进 API 权限的不断优化,形成良好的互动氛围。
- 举办开发者活动:定期举办线上或线下的开发者活动,如技术研讨会、黑客松等,如同举办一场盛大的聚会,在活动中,邀请行业专家分享最新的区块链技术和 API 应用趋势,同时为优秀的开发者和应用提供奖励和展示机会,激发开发者的创新热情,推动开发者社区的繁荣发展。
ImToken 钱包 API 权限,宛如一条灵动的纽带,紧密连接着用户、开发者和数字资产生态,在保障用户数字资产安全的坚实基础上,合理开放和管理 API 权限,必将极大地推动数字资产行业的创新发展,通过加强安全考量、优化权限管理流程、完善权限文档和建设开发者社区等一系列切实举措,ImToken 定能实现 API 权限在安全与便捷之间的精妙平衡,为数字资产的未来发展筑牢根基,随着技术的日新月异和行业的日益成熟,ImToken 钱包 API 权限必将在更多领域绽放光彩,引领数字资产应用迈向更加广阔的天地,书写数字资产领域的辉煌篇章。



